How To Fix NET024 - Procedure if a service is not available


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: NET - Network Messages

  • Message number: 024

  • Message text: Procedure if a service is not available

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message NET024 - Procedure if a service is not available ?

    The SAP error message NET024 typically indicates that a service is not available, which can occur in various contexts within the SAP system, particularly in relation to network services or communication between different components of the SAP landscape.

    Cause:

    The NET024 error can arise due to several reasons, including but not limited to:

    1. Service Unavailability: The specific service that the system is trying to access is down or not running.
    2. Network Issues: There may be network connectivity problems preventing access to the service.
    3. Configuration Errors: Incorrect configuration settings in the SAP system or in the network settings can lead to this error.
    4. Authorization Issues: The user or system may not have the necessary permissions to access the service.
    5. Firewall or Security Settings: Firewalls or security settings may be blocking access to the service.

    Solution:

    To resolve the NET024 error, you can follow these steps:

    1. Check Service Status: Verify that the service you are trying to access is up and running. This may involve checking the relevant application server or service status in the SAP system.

    2. Network Connectivity: Ensure that there are no network issues. You can use tools like ping or traceroute to check connectivity to the service.

    3. Review Configuration: Check the configuration settings in the SAP system. Ensure that the service endpoint, ports, and other relevant settings are correctly configured.

    4. Authorization Check: Make sure that the user or system has the necessary authorizations to access the service. You may need to consult with your SAP security team to verify this.

    5. Firewall Settings: If applicable, check the firewall settings to ensure that they are not blocking access to the service. You may need to work with your network security team to adjust these settings.

    6. Logs and Traces: Review the SAP application logs and traces for more detailed error messages that can provide additional context about the issue.

    7. Restart Services: If the service is down, restarting the service or the application server may resolve the issue.

    8.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or support notes related to the specific service you are trying to access for any known issues or additional troubleshooting steps.

    Related Information:

    • SAP Notes: Check SAP Notes for any known issues related to the NET024 error. SAP frequently updates its knowledge base with solutions to common problems.
    • SAP Community: Engage with the SAP Community forums to see if other users have encountered similar issues and what solutions they have found.
    • System Monitoring Tools: Utilize SAP monitoring tools (like Solution Manager) to keep track of service availability and performance.

    If the issue persists after following these steps, it may be necessary to escalate the problem to SAP support for further assistance.
